Concrete replacement services involve removing old, damaged, or deteriorated concrete surfaces and installing new, durable material in their place. This process is often necessary when existing concrete has become cracked, crumbling, or uneven due to weather, age, or heavy use. Skilled contractors carefully break up and remove the compromised concrete, then prepare the underlying surface before pouring and finishing fresh concrete to restore the area’s stability and appearance. Properly executed, concrete replacement can significantly improve both the safety and visual appeal of outdoor spaces, driveways, walkways, or other concrete structures.
Many common problems signal the need for concrete replacement. Cracks that widen over time can pose tripping hazards or allow water to seep underneath, leading to further damage. Settling or sinking sections can cause uneven surfaces that are difficult to walk or drive on safely. Spalling, where the surface flakes or chips away, not only looks unsightly but also weakens the overall structure. In some cases, old concrete may be stained, stained, or stained beyond repair, prompting replacement to achieve a cleaner, more attractive finish. These issues can develop gradually or suddenly, making prompt assessment and repair essential.

The overview below groups typical Concrete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Lee County, AL.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or concrete replacement projects, such as patching or small sections, usually range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the scope and material used.
Medium-Scale Replacement - Replacing larger concrete slabs or driveways generally costs between $1,200-$3,500. Projects in this range are common for homeowners upgrading or repairing existing structures.
Full Driveway Replacement - Complete driveway replacements often fall between $4,000-$8,000, depending on size, design, and concrete type. Larger, more complex projects can sometimes reach $10,000+ but are less frequent.
Commercial or Large-Scale Projects - Large commercial concrete replacements or multi-area jobs can start around $10,000 and may exceed $20,000 for extensive work. These projects are less typical but handled by specialized local contractors for larger clients.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
